Valley Gardens

The Valley Gardens are 250 acres of botanical garden, planted with exotic azaleas, magnolias and other blooms from all over the world . It is part of the Crown Estate on the eastern edge of Windsor Great Park.

Flora

My father was a photography enthusiast and he passed this passion to me when he offered me my first camera, a Pentax K1000 when I was a teenager. I could not stop photographing since. He loved photographing flowers and this is one of my favourite subjects too.
